資源描述:
《一步一學(xué)linux與windows 共享文件samba (v0.2b)》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、作者:北南南北,正在增加中......需要您的參與;來自:LinuxSir.Org簡介:本文只是講一講我們最常用的Linux與Windows共享文件,主要是為新手指一指路。如何建立最簡單的Samba服務(wù)器,并講述遇到問題應(yīng)該從何處尋找解決方案;正在更新之中,希望您的參加......謝謝;目錄0、架設(shè)Samba服務(wù)器的前提;0.1查看文件內(nèi)容和編輯文件的工具;0.2關(guān)于文件和目錄相關(guān);03用戶和用戶組相關(guān);04進(jìn)程管理;1Samba簡介2Samba功能和應(yīng)用范圍3Samba兩個服務(wù)器相關(guān)啟動程序、客戶端及服務(wù)器配
2、置文件等;3.1Samba有兩個服務(wù)器,一個是smbd,另一個是nmbd;3.2查看Samba服務(wù)器的端口及防火墻;3.3查看Samba服務(wù)器的配置文件;3.4Samba在Linux中的一些工具(服務(wù)器端和客戶端);3.5在Linux中的常用工具,Windows查看Linux共享的方法;3.5.1在Linux系統(tǒng)中查看網(wǎng)絡(luò)中Windows共享文件及Linux中的Samba共享文件;3.5.2在Windows中訪問LinuxSamba服務(wù)器共享文件的辦法;3.5.3smbfs文件系統(tǒng)的掛載;4由最簡單的一個例子說
3、起,匿名用戶可讀可寫的實現(xiàn);第一步:更改smb.conf第二步:建立相應(yīng)目錄并授權(quán);第三步:啟動smbd和nmbd服務(wù)器;第四步:查看smbd進(jìn)程,確認(rèn)Samba服務(wù)器是否運行起來了;第五步:訪問Samba服務(wù)器的共享;5、復(fù)雜一點的用戶共享模型(適合10人左右的小型企業(yè));5.1共享權(quán)限設(shè)計實現(xiàn)的功能;5.2在服務(wù)器上創(chuàng)建相應(yīng)的目錄;5.3添加用戶用戶組,設(shè)置相應(yīng)目錄家目錄的權(quán)限;5.3.1添加用戶組;5.3.2添加用戶;5.3.3添加samba用戶,并設(shè)置密碼;5.3.4配置相關(guān)目錄的權(quán)限和歸屬;5.4修改
4、Samba配置文件;5.5關(guān)于客戶端訪問;5.5.1Windows客戶端訪問;++++++++++++++++++++++++++++++++++++++++++++++++正文++++++++++++++++++++++++++++++++++++++++++++++++0、架設(shè)Samba服務(wù)器的前提;Linux是一個多用戶的操作系統(tǒng),對任何服務(wù)器的架設(shè)與都用戶、用戶組及權(quán)限相關(guān),這是操作的基礎(chǔ)。Samba服務(wù)器也不例外,對這些知識的掌握也是極為重要的。在Windows系統(tǒng)上雖然也能架共享文件服務(wù)器,但它的權(quán)
5、限控制實在令人不敢恭維。如果我們用Windows系統(tǒng)來架網(wǎng)絡(luò)共享文件系統(tǒng),就是點鼠標(biāo)也能把我們點迷糊了。但在Linux中,我們可以輕松的改一改配置文件,不到幾分鐘就能建好自己的Samba服務(wù)器。哪個更容易,只有你知道;對于Samba服務(wù)器的架設(shè),有的弟兄簡單的認(rèn)為,只要把改一下配置文件,創(chuàng)建好相應(yīng)的目錄就行了。其實并不是這樣的,還要深入的工作,比如目錄的權(quán)限和歸屬,也就是說能讓哪個用戶和用戶組有讀寫權(quán)。只有把配置文件和共享目錄的權(quán)限結(jié)合起來,才能架好Samba服務(wù)器;下面是常用的基礎(chǔ)知識,我們在本文中所涉及的內(nèi)
6、容都可以在下面的列表中找到相應(yīng)的解釋;0.1查看文件內(nèi)容和編輯文件的工具;《Linux文件內(nèi)容查看工具介紹》《文件編輯器vi》0.2關(guān)于文件和目錄相關(guān);《Linux文件類型及文件的擴(kuò)展名》《Linux文件和目錄管理之列出、刪除、復(fù)制、移動及改名》《Linux文件和目錄的屬性》《簡述Linux文件搜索》03用戶和用戶組相關(guān);《Linux用戶(user)和用戶組(group)管理概述》《用戶(User)和用戶組(Group)配置文件詳解》《Linux用戶管理工具介紹》《Linux用戶(User)查詢篇》04進(jìn)程管理
7、;《Linux進(jìn)程管理》1Samba簡介Samba(SMB是其縮寫)是一個網(wǎng)絡(luò)服務(wù)器,用于Linux和Windows共享文件之用;Samba即可以用于Windows和Linux之間的共享文件,也一樣用于Linux和Linux之間的共享文件;不過對于Linux和Linux之間共享文件有更好的網(wǎng)絡(luò)文件系統(tǒng)NFS,NFS也是需要架設(shè)服務(wù)器的;大家知道在Windows網(wǎng)絡(luò)中的每臺機(jī)器即可以是文件共享的服務(wù)器,也可以同是客戶機(jī);Samba也一樣能行,比如一臺Linux的機(jī)器,如果架了SambaServer后,它能充當(dāng)共享
8、服務(wù)器,同時也能做為客戶機(jī)來訪問其它網(wǎng)絡(luò)中的Windows共享文件系統(tǒng),或其它Linux的Sabmba服務(wù)器;我們在Windows網(wǎng)絡(luò)中,看到共享文件功能知道,我們直接就可以把共享文件夾當(dāng)做本地硬盤來使用。在Linux的中,就是通過Samba的向網(wǎng)絡(luò)中的機(jī)器提供共享文件系統(tǒng),也可以把網(wǎng)絡(luò)中其它機(jī)器的共享掛載在本地機(jī)上使用;這在一定意義上說和FTP是不一樣的。Samba用的netbios